Development of the UH-60 Blackhawk: From Idea to Deployment

Officially introduced to the Army in 1979, the Blackhawk was a substantial innovation in rotorcraft innovation, including twin engines for greater power and redundancy, an unbreakable fuselage, and advanced avionics. Its capacity to carry 11 completely equipped soldiers or a 2600-pound haul highlighted its versatility and enhanced functional capabilities. For many years, it has been continually upgraded to incorporate the most recent in armed forces modern technology, ensuring its importance in contemporary armed forces operations.
